Old King William IV House, Egremont Street, Ely

History of Old King William IV House

Listed Building

Old King William IV House, a former timber-framed house of C17 date, altered and subdivided into two cottages in the late-C18/early-C19, with later-C19 alterations as a public house, now a single dwelling.
